x64: Add support for phadd{w,d} instructions (#5896)
This commit adds support for the bare lowering of the `iadd_pairwise` instruction with `i16x8` and `i32x4` types on the x64 backend. These lowerings are achieved with the `phaddw` and `phaddd` instructions, respectively. Additionally AVX encodings of these instructions are added too. The motivation for these new lowerings comes from the relaxed-simd proposal which will use them in the deterministic lowering of some instructions on the x64 backend.
